Advantages: new down town area, new items

Disadvantages: harder to form/maintain relationships, memory space

This new expansion pack for The Sims game by maxis adds a whole new dimension. Your Sims can now leave the housing lot and go Downtown where they can eat out in a restaurant, party in a club, shop, or simply chill out in a park. Along with all the new skins and items, the social interactions change making it a lot harder for your Sims to fall (and stay) in love. The way you make friends becomes slightly more complicated, too. As well as the usual status bar for friendship, there?s a second bar which goes up the longer you know a Sim for.

The downside of all this new and exciting gameplay is that it takes up a lot of memory. I didn?t have enough space on my previous computer, and the game kept crashing whenever I went downtown.

As well as designing houses, you can also design your own downtown areas where your Sims can hang out. It certainly adds even more fun to the game, and any fan of the Sims should buy a copy.
